Course Highlights
This former private course offers a distinctive layout and upscale charm that sets it apart from typical public options. Friendly, encouraging staff consistently enhance the experience from the first tee through the back nine.

Malfunctions of Golf Carts Affecting Player Experience

The golf carts on the course experienced significant GPS issues that day. They frequently malfunctioned, even when staying on the cart path, causing several groups including ours to get stuck at various points. We often had to drive the carts in reverse through cart paths and rough terrain, which was quite challenging. We've played on many courses, including those with higher ratings than Rock Spring, and have not encountered this kind of geofencing issue before. Additionally, despite the 7:15 PM return time, the carts continued to beep the entire way back to the clubhouse, even after they were returned. This made for a frustrating experience, and it would greatly improve the overall enjoyment if the carts were properly programmed and maintained.
